^(60)Co—γ射线辐照中药材杀虫灭菌效果及主要有效成分变化的研究 被引量:8

STUDIES ON THE INSECTIDAL AND STERILIZATION EFFICACY OF ^(60)Co γ-RAY IRRADIATION ON TRADITIONAL CHINESE DRUGS AND CHANGE IN THEIR MAJOR CONSTITUENTS

摘要 本文为应用^(60)Co—γ射线辐照边条红参(Radix Ginseng)、当归(Radix AnselicaeSinensis)、槟榔(Semen Arecae)等21种中药材杀虫、灭菌效果及其主要有效成分变化的研究。结果表明,辐照杀虫剂量范围为1.5~2.3kGy;灭菌剂量范围为3.8~7.6kGy;以3.7~20.6kGy剂量辐照边条红参、当归头、槟榔、其主要有效成分人参总皂甙、人参单体皂甙Rg_1,当归挥发油以及榔槟生物碱的颜色和百分含量均无明显变化,杀虫、灭菌效果显著,防止二次感染、辐照后贮藏一年仍可达到色鲜、味正、不生虫、不发霉的良好效果。 The insecticidal and sterilization efficacy of 60Co Y -ray irradiation on traditional Chinesedrugs, and change in their major constituents were investigated.The effective exposure dose ranges for insects and bacteria were found to be 1.5-2.3 kGy ar,d 3.8 - 7.6 kGy respectively. There was no obvious change in the major constituentsof 3 kinds of traditional Chinese drugs subjected to irradiation. After sterilization, a plastic bag outside the original package must be added in order to prevent recontamination.It could keep fresh for as long as 1 year.
